Hexagon Head Bolts vs. Square Head Bolts: Key Differences and Applications

When selecting the appropriate fastener for a project, understanding the nuances of different bolt head types is crucial. Two common choices are hexagon head bolts and square head bolts, each offering distinct advantages ideal for specific applications.

Hexagon head bolts, with their six-sided shape, provide a secure grip for standard wrenches, enabling efficient tightening and loosening. Their design facilitates even torque distribution, reducing the risk of stripping or rounding the fastener. Conversely, square head bolts feature a flat, four-sided top surface, which can be driven with a specialized square socket wrench. This unique configuration provides a more secure fit and prevents rotation during installation.

The choice between hexagon head and square head bolts often depends on factors such as the required torque, accessibility of the fastener location, and personal preference. Hexagon head bolts are frequently employed in applications demanding high torque transmission, while square head bolts find use in situations where resistance to rotation is paramount.

Picking the Right Bolt: A Comparison of Hexagon, Square Head, and Carriage Bolts

When it comes to hardware elements in a construction project, selecting the appropriate bolt is crucial. There are numerous types of bolts available, each with its own unique characteristics and applications. Among these common types are hexagon, square head, and carriage bolts.

  • Six-sided head bolts offer a wide range of diameters. They provide a strong grip when fastened using a wrench due to their multifaceted shape.
  • Square head bolts are known for their robustness. Their square shape prevents them from rotating once placed, making them suitable for applications where stability is paramount.
